I'm ditching my New Balance shoes for these Skechers on my 3 mile runs — here's why

I've relied on New Balance Fresh Foam running shoes for years. I think they offer great arch support and are super comfortable to wear, and in my opinion are some of the best running shoes. But I didn't know that I was missing a whole other level of comfort until I tested the Skechers Max Cushioning Elite 2.0. They are so comfortable to wear even just for walking around, but when I took them on a run for the first time I set a new PR for my 3-mile run. I have been relying on the Skechers Max Cushioning Elite 2.0 sneakers for runs for over a month and they have incredible bounce to help me move faster with fewer aches and pains. So yes, the change in shoes has made me a little faster but the comfort and support from them alone makes it worth the change. The midsole of the shoe is made from memory foam and a PU (polyurethane) foam which, when put together, creates a bouncy and springy walk. The Skechers Air-Cooled Goga Mat technology also provides further cushioning for high intensity exercise. The sole has a two-inch lift and I could really feel the effect of this from the shock absorption the shoe offers. My poor knees bear the brunt of the effects of my running, and in the weeks I have used these sneakers I haven't had any aches or pains. I have also noticed the elevation from the sole means I am leaning forward ever so slightly, so the shoes will automatically propel you forward with every step you take. These shoes are totally breathable and kept my feet far cooler than my usual New Balances. And while the mesh upper of the shoe makes for a cool running experience, it's not so great for running in the rain. Skechers are of course known for their breathability, but I didn't quite understand the hype until trying these out. While the Goga Mat technology works to cushion the show, it also has a cooling effect. This is also in the Skechers' Go Run Elevate 2.0 sneakers and makes them extremely comfortable to wear for long periods. We have awarded the Skechers Go Run Elevate 2.0 a coveted 4-stars. They are a great option for new runners as the elevated sole makes them bouncy, and they are lightweight to make every step easy. Most Skechers shoes come with a wide fit option, but I would say the Max Cushioning Elite 2.0 run wide anyway. While I have narrow feet, there was more than enough room in the regular fit version of these sneakers. That meant there was plenty of room in the toe box and no squished toes in sight, This is an issue I find with a lot of sneakers I wear, where the toe box tapers to almost a point. While the Skechers still have a flattering shape, they are not constrictive. I have very arched feet from years of ballet training, so when I don't have enough support from my shoes I really feel it. And as a chronic Doc Martens wearer, I know the impact of an uncomfortable shoe. By having extra support in the arch area of my foot, my runs have become more comfortable, but that's not the best part. Usually a little while after a run, my arches can become slightly sore without the right support, and this is something I was experiencing with my previous running shoes. Since switching to Skechers I haven't had any aches. I will definitely be sticking with Skechers for my short runs from now on. For longer runs I would still go down the route of a sturdier shoe like the Asics Novablast 5, but for short training runs where you need to prioritize comfort? I can't recommend these Skechers enough.

Kelly Brook ran the London Marathon in New Balance trainers that are ‘like running on clouds'

Kelly Brook opted for a pair of New Balance's Fresh Foam trainers to run the London Marathon, and shoppers say they're so comfortable they're like 'running on clouds' The London Marathon is over for another year, and if it's inspired you to start training for the next one – or even just to get into running full stop – the right pair of shoes is essential. Arguably the most important bit of kit you'll need when running is some comfortable and supportive trainers, and Kelly Brook picked the perfect pair for her impressive marathon performance. The model was spotted crossing the finish line in a pair of New Balance's Fresh Foam X 1080 v14 Shoes, which have been widely praised by reviewers for their comfort and support. The trainers are currently available for £160 and come in a choice of three different widths, with plenty of cushioning to make sure you can run all 26 miles in total comfort. To create that all important support, the Fresh Foam X trainers have midsole cushioning which helps your feet with each transition from landing to push off whilst running, with a rocker design that helps create a much smoother movement. They also have soft, flexible uppers which give you plenty of support and keep your feet in place, and a solid rubber outsole that prevents wearing as well as forefoot stiffness. The uppers are made from mesh, which helps your feet breathe too, so no unnecessary sweating which can lead to rubbing. The Fresh Foam X trainers are also mega lightweight, weighing just 235.6g so your feet don't feel weighed down. The Fresh Foam X trainers have been praised for helping with everything from back pain to joint pain, with shoppers praising them for how lightweight and comfortable they are.
